Dracaena marginata 'Wave', also known as Madagascar Dragon Tree 'Wave', is a striking variety of the Dracaena marginata species. It is renowned for its unique, wavy foliage and graceful appearance, making it a popular choice for modern interiors and tropical-themed spaces. This plant is hardy and low-maintenance, perfect for both novice and experienced plant enthusiasts.

 

Key Features:

 

1. Foliage:

 

The leaves are long, slender, and distinctly wavy, giving the plant its name.

 

The foliage is typically green, sometimes with lighter green or grayish hues, creating a textured, rippled effect.

 

The leaves grow in a rosette pattern at the top of the stems, adding to its architectural appeal.

 

 

 

2. Growth Habit:

 

A slow-growing, upright plant that can reach 4-6 feet indoors under proper conditions.

 

Has a cane-like trunk that enhances its sculptural appearance.

 

 

 

3. Light Requirements:

 

Thrives in bright, indirect light but can tolerate lower light levels, although growth may slow.

 

Avoid direct sunlight, as it can scorch the delicate leaves.

 

 

 

4. Watering:

 

Water when the top inch of soil feels dry.

 

Ensure the pot has proper drainage to prevent waterlogging and root rot.

 

 

 

5. Humidity and Temperature:

 

Prefers moderate to high humidity but adapts well to standard indoor conditions.

 

Ideal temperatures range from 18-26°C (65-80°F). Avoid exposure to cold drafts or temperatures below 12°C (54°F).

 

 

 

6. Soil:

 

Requires a well-draining potting mix. A mix designed for houseplants with added perlite or sand is ideal.

 

 

 

7. Propagation:

 

Propagates through stem cuttings or air layering.

 

Propagation is most successful during the growing season (spring or summer).

 

 

 

8. Care Tips:

 

Fertilize monthly during the growing season with a balanced liquid fertilizer at half strength.

 

Prune to maintain its shape and remove any yellowing or damaged leaves.

 

Clean the leaves periodically to remove dust and promote healthy growth.

 

 

 

 

Additional Notes:

 

Dracaena marginata 'Wave' is an excellent air purifier, improving indoor air quality by removing toxins like formaldehyde and benzene.

 

It is mildly toxic to pets if ingested, so it should be placed out of reach of cats and dogs.

 

 

With its wavy foliage and striking silhouette, Dracaena marginata 'Wave' adds a touch of elegance and tropical flair to any space. It is a versatile, low-maintenance plant that can thrive in a variety of indoor environments.
